Web(A) Banded iron formation from the early Paleoproterozoic Dales Gorge Member of the Brockman Iron Formation, Hamersley basin of Western Australia. Clear part is chert pod with opaque hematite impurities, dark part is dominantly magnetite; note the contrast in thickness and sharpness of laminae as they exit the chert pod into the surrounding BIF. WebWhat are banded iron formations? Units of sedimentary rock of Precambrian age consisting of alternating layers of iron oxides and chert. Why are banded iron formations important? They are an important source of iron for large-scale mining. What form of iron is mined, why is it in this form? Fe3+. This is because this oxidised version of iron is ...
